The design for this hat came about thanks to two things: first, the Ravelry Designer’s Challenge, based on a woodland theme, and second, my roommate needed a new hat! It’s the sister pattern to my Woodland Mittens.

She wanted something that was thick and warm with a brim that could fold up over the ears. So, I started experimenting with different hat designs, but most of them didn’t seem warm enough. After trying various knitted linings, I came up with this idea. It’s thick, warm, and heavy enough to keep all but the worst of the winter winds out!

The result is a cabled hat knit in the round from the brim up, using a provisional cast on to create a double-layered, lined hat. It is completely reversible, so you don’t have to worry about which way you wear it!
